00问答网
所有问题
当前搜索:
c语言中定义字符串的方法
gets和getchar的区别
答:
首先,gets和getchar都是
C语言中
用来读取
字符的
函数,但它们在使用
方式
和功能上有一些不同。 gets()函数:这个函数可以从标准输入(通常是键盘)读取一
串字符
,直到遇到换行符(Enter键)为止。换行符是输入结束的标志。读取的字符被存储在字符串中,字符串以空字符('\0')结尾。 例如,如果你输入“Hello World”,gets()...
C语言中
strcpy是什么意思?
答:
在
C语言中
,`strcpy` 是一个标准库函数,用于复制字符串。它的原型在 `string.h` 头文件
中定义
,功能是将源字符串(包括终止空字符 `'\0'`)复制到目标字符串中。函数的原型如下:```c char *strcpy(char *dest, const char *src);```这里的 `dest` 是目标
字符串的
指针,它应该指向足够大...
C语言
自
定义
一个函数int length(char *s),函数返回
字符串
s
的
长度。
答:
include <stdio.h> int length(char *s);int main(void){ int len;char str[80];char ch;do { printf("Enter string(whthin 80 characters): ");gets(str);len = length(str);printf("输入
字符串的
长度为:%d\n", len);printf("\nDo you want continue y/n: \n");scanf(" %
c
"...
c语言
:
定义
两个字符数组,在其中存入随机输入
的字符串
,然后比较两个字符...
答:
nLength=strlen(c2);//字符串长度总是取小的那个 strcat(c1,c2);//把短
的字符串
接到长的后面 } else{ nLength=strlen(c1);//字符串长度总是取小的那个 strcat(c2,c1);//把短的字符串接到长的后面 } for(int i=0;i<nLength;i++){ if(c1[i]==c2[i])printf("%
c
",c1[i]);...
一些有关
C语言中
实用且很牛的技能!
答:
现在,假设我们想为每个错误码提供一个错误描述的
字符串
。为了确保数组保持了最新
的定义
,无论头文件做了任何修改或增补,我们都可以用这个数组指定的语法。 这样就可以静态分配足够的空间,且保证最大的索引是合法的,同时将特殊的索引初始化为指定的值,并将剩下的索引初始化为0。 三、结构体与联合体 用结构体与联合...
c语言中
,如何把
字符串
,如“abcdef”赋值个一个变量,怎么
定义
该...
答:
其实用c也很简单的,c里有用于处理
字符串的
头文件string.h strcat()函数就是将两个字符串连接 不过在
c里面
是没字符串变量这个概念的,用字符指针来实现 下面是程序 include"stdio.h"include"stdlib.h"include"string.h"main(){ char send = "whatyouwant";/*用你想要的东西代替whatyouwant稍改一...
在
c语言中
,
字符串
常量的定界符是什么?
答:
需要注意的是,单引号(' ')在C语言中用于表示字符常量,而不是字符串常量。字符常量只能包含一个字符,而字符串常量可以包含多个字符。例如,'a' 是一个字符常量,而 "abc" 是一个字符串常量。总的来说,双引号是
C语言中字符串
常量的定界符,它们用于
定义
和识别字符串常量,并在字符串中包含特殊...
C语言中的字符
变量用什么保留字说明
答:
C语言中的字符变量用保留字char来
定义
。每个字符变量中只能存放一个字符。在一般系统中,一个字符变量在计算机内存中占一个字节。与字符常量一样,字符变量也可以出现在任何允许整型变量参与的运算中。
C语言中的字符串
常量是由一对双引号括起来的字符序列。注意不要将字符常量和字符串常量混淆,没有专门的...
c语言
如何
定义字符
数组
答:
定义字符
数组
的方法
,与定义整数数组或浮点数数组并无二致,都是完全一样的。例如,以下的语句,可以定义一个最多存放1000个
字符的
字符数组:char s[1000];
c语言
如何输入数字和单个
字符串
答:
这种
方法
和输入数字是类似的,%
c
仅读入一个字符,并赋值给c。2 c = getchar();getchar函数的功能就是读入一个字符,并以返回值形式返回。三、输入一
串字符
(以空白字符分隔)。可以用scanf的%s格式。char str[100];//空间要
定义
足够大 scanf("%s", str);//将
字符串
读入并存在str中 四,读入...
棣栭〉
<涓婁竴椤
4
5
6
7
9
10
8
11
12
13
涓嬩竴椤
灏鹃〉
其他人还搜